Installing the ADO Service
This section describes how to install and configure the ThingWorx ADO Service to connect to a Microsoft database source.
As an example, if you plan to connect an SQL Server to the ThingWorx platform through a firewall using the ThingWorx WebSocket-based Edge MicroServer and the ThingWorx Edge .NET SDK, you would install the ThingWorx ADO Service on the same client as the SQL Server.
To install the ThingWorx ADO Service, do the following:
1. Obtain the ThingWorx ADO Service application (version 5.5.0 or later). You can download the ThingWorx ADO Service application from the PTC Software Downloads page.
If you want to use an embedded FIPS module, make sure that you download the FIPS version of the ADO service and the .NET SDK.
2. Extract the files from the ZIP file to install.
3. From the Start menu, right-click Command Prompt and select Run As Administrator.
If you do not select Run As Administrator when launching a Command Prompt window, the installation of the ADO as a service will fail with an exception similar to the following:
An exception occurred during the Install phase.
System.InvalidOperationException: Cannot open Service Control Manager on computer '.'.
This operation might require other privileges.
The inner exception System.ComponentModel.Win32Exception was thrown with the
following error message: Access is denied.
4. From the command line, run the following on the remote PC:
InstallUtil.exe ThingworxADOService.exe
where InstallUtil can be found in C:\Windows\Microsoft.NET\Framework\v4.0.30319\ on 32 bit systems, and C:\Windows\Microsoft.NET\Framework64\v4.0.30319\ on 64 bit systems.
5. Continue to the next section to learn How to Perform a Basic Configuration.